" All the World is Birthday Cake " is the fifth episode of the second season of the sci-fi series . The episode serves as a heavy social commentary on xenophobia, prejudice, and the dangers of blind faith , specifically targeting how arbitrary systems (like astrology) can be used to justify systemic oppression. Plot Summary
The crew of the Orville makes first contact with the Regorians, a civilization that has just begun transmitting signals into space. While the initial meeting is friendly, the mood shifts instantly when the Regorians learn that Commander Kelly Grayson and Second Officer Bortus have upcoming birthdays. In Regorian culture, those born under the "Giliac" zodiac sign are considered inherently violent and low-born. Because Kelly and Bortus are Giliacs, they are immediately arrested and sent to a brutal internment camp. The episode follows Captain Mercer’s attempt to negotiate their release while the prisoners navigate the horrors of a society built on "astrological eugenics."
